The Story Behind Rafhael
The name Raphael has ancient Hebrew origins, derived from the elements 'rapha' meaning 'to heal' and 'El' meaning 'God'. It is a name with significant religious importance, primarily associated with the Archangel Raphael, one of the seven archangels in Abrahamic religions. In the Book of Tobit, Raphael is depicted as a benevolent healer and guide, restoring sight to Tobit and helping his son Tobias.
The spelling 'Rafhael' is a variant, particularly common in Portuguese and Spanish-speaking cultures, reflecting phonetic adaptations of the original Hebrew and Latin forms. The name has been consistently used across centuries due to its strong spiritual connotations and the positive attributes associated with the archangel, symbolizing divine healing and protection.
